#784c58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#784c58 is composed of 47.1% red, 29.8%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.7% magenta, 26.7%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 343.6 degrees, a saturation of 22.4% and a lightness of 38.4%. #784c58 color hex could be obtained by blending #f098b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#784c58 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.
#784c58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#784c58 has RGB values of R:120, G:76,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.27,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7883864.
